Great Britain’s Sonay Kartal was knocked out in the first round of the Abu Dhabi Open after losing in three sets to American Katie Volynets.
Kartal, 23, took the opening set against world number 68 Volynets but fell to a 3-6 6-4 6-4 loss.
The 91st-ranked Englishwoman broke into the world’s top 100 for the first time at the end of last season.
She was playing for the first time since making her overseas Grand Slam debut at the Australian Open last month, exiting in the first round.
Kartal recovered from losing serve in the opening game to turn around the first set, which she clinched by taking a third consecutive game.
Volynets, also 23, raced into a 5-0 lead in the second set as she took the match to a decider.
But that was only after she survived a scare as Kartal threatened an unlikely comeback, the Briton battling back to 5-4 before losing serve for a third time.
There were six consecutive breaks of serve as the players scrapped for the decisive breakthrough in the final set, and it was Volynets who struck with a first match point to set up a second-round meeting with top seed Elena Rybakina.
